Taqdees is an Arabic name meaning 'sanctification' or 'glorification' of Allah. The name is derived from the root 'q-d-s' which relates to purity and holiness. In Islamic theology, Taqdees refers to the act of declaring Allah as Holy and Pure, free from all imperfections. It is a name that reflects deep spiritual devotion and recognition of Allah's absolute perfection. This name is rare and unique, often chosen by families seeking a name with profound religious significance.
